Strategies for Optimizing Phlebotomy Procedures for Aging Populations: Training, Technology, and Communication
Summary
- Implementing proper training and Continuing Education programs for phlebotomists
- Utilizing technology to streamline processes and reduce errors
- Enhancing communication between Healthcare Providers and patients
As the population in the United States continues to age, the demand for medical services, including laboratory testing, is on the rise. Phlebotomy, the practice of drawing blood for diagnostic testing, plays a crucial role in the healthcare system. However, with an increasing number of elderly patients requiring lab work, it is essential for medical labs to implement strategies to ensure safe and effective phlebotomy procedures for aging populations.
Training Programs
Medical labs can ensure the safety of phlebotomy procedures by implementing comprehensive training programs for phlebotomists. These programs should cover essential topics such as infection control, patient identification, and proper technique for Venipuncture. By ensuring that phlebotomists are well-trained, labs can reduce the risk of complications and errors during blood collection.
Continuing Education
In addition to initial training, medical labs should provide ongoing education opportunities for phlebotomists. Continuing Education programs can help phlebotomists stay up-to-date on the latest techniques and best practices in blood collection. This can ultimately lead to improved patient outcomes and reduced instances of adverse events.
Barcoding Systems
Implementing barcoding systems can help medical labs ensure accurate patient identification during phlebotomy procedures. By scanning a patient's wristband and the specimen tubes, phlebotomists can verify that the samples are correctly labeled and matched to the right patient. This can reduce the risk of misidentification errors and ensure the integrity of the Test Results.
Electronic Health Records
Electronic Health Records (EHRs) can streamline the phlebotomy process by providing phlebotomists with access to critical patient information. EHRs can help phlebotomists identify any specific instructions or precautions for elderly patients, such as potential medication interactions or allergies. By leveraging technology, medical labs can enhance the efficiency and accuracy of phlebotomy procedures for aging populations.
Communication with Healthcare Providers
Effective communication between phlebotomists and Healthcare Providers is essential for ensuring safe and effective phlebotomy procedures. Medical labs should encourage open communication channels between phlebotomists and providers to discuss any special considerations for elderly patients. This can help address any potential risks or concerns before the blood collection process begins.
Communication with Patients
Clear communication with patients is crucial for ensuring their comfort and safety during phlebotomy procedures. Phlebotomists should explain the procedure to aging patients in a clear and compassionate manner, addressing any concerns or questions they may have. By establishing trust and rapport with patients, phlebotomists can help alleviate anxiety and ensure a positive experience for aging populations.
Medical labs in the United States can implement various strategies to ensure safe and effective phlebotomy procedures for aging populations. By offering comprehensive training and Continuing Education programs for phlebotomists, utilizing technology to streamline processes, and enhancing communication with Healthcare Providers and patients, labs can optimize the blood collection process for elderly patients. Ultimately, these strategies can help improve patient outcomes and enhance the quality of care provided to aging populations.
